## Retirement Plan: Kestrel Series (Managers Only)

Branch managers: The Kestrel product line retires over three quarters. Remaining stock is discounted per the schedule on this page; no returns to central warehouse after the cutoff. Service commitments continue for two years via the Halloway support desk. Migration offers to the Merrow line begin next month. The confidential note below explains how this fits our wider plans.

management briefing: The renewal with Zoraelax Group closes at $10 million a year, 15 percent below the last contract. Project Ralael slips by six weeks because of the audit delay.

## Fire Drill — Roll Call Procedure

Facilities desk runs roll call at Muster Point A, Oakhurst Yard. Bring the printed badge register and the visitor sheet. Mark absentees; report them to the drill marshal immediately. Nobody re-enters until the all-clear. To unlock the register cabinet by the south exit, use the code below.

staff pass of kagef-yahip = bdg-TKELFT-63915354

## Gridwell Environments

Welcome aboard! Quick heads-up: the spreadsheet export worker in Gridwell staging is memory-hungry. Big exports (10k+ rows) can spike the heap, so staging runs with tighter limits than prod. If your export jobs get killed, that's usually why. Before tweaking anything, check the current limits. Here are the staging values we run today.

deployment values, kajep-kageg:
[praix]
host = praix.paliqcorp.corp
user = praix_svc
database = praix_prod

**Vendor note: Inkmill markdown pipeline**

Rendering for Parchway docs is outsourced to Inkmill under an annual contract, renewing each March. They handle sanitization and PDF export; we own the upload queue. SLA: 4-hour response on rendering failures. Escalate only after two failed retries. Their support desk is reachable at the address below.

billing contact of hahaf-baguf = zorael.tammir.jorius@sivrelhq.internal